Transaction 34b8d353ceee8e9a9705fb8ecb032d42e52a161664e0c77d52bc14ba6646f01f

1 Input
2 Outputs
  • 34b8d353ceee8e9a9705fb8ecb032d42e52a161664e0c77d52bc14ba6646f01f:0
  • value  14772809
    address  199MiHBC9cYQpup8xtp2VwpLf6FQEzX1eE
  • 34b8d353ceee8e9a9705fb8ecb032d42e52a161664e0c77d52bc14ba6646f01f:1
  • value  997657
    address  1CrytGWYzcy4LkrB9KawFBSZX8uXHSMByL